The Miami Hurricanes
Representing the University of Miami, the Miami Hurricanes, famously known as ‘The U,’ are a powerhouse in college athletics. With a legacy built on swagger and dominance, particularly in football, the Hurricanes captured five national championships between 1983 and 2001, creating a dynasty that redefined the sport. The atmosphere at Hard Rock Stadium is electric, fueled by a passionate fan base that lives and breathes orange and green. Stitching the iconic ‘U’ logo is more than a craft; it’s a tribute to a tradition of excellence, resilience, and unforgettable moments in NCAA history.
The Symbolism of Green and Orange
The vibrant green and orange of the Hurricanes are a direct reflection of their Florida roots. The orange represents the state’s most famous citrus fruit, the Florida orange, and the abundant sunshine, while the green symbolizes the lush foliage of the orange trees and the subtropical landscape. Together, these colors create a bold and energetic palette that perfectly captures the spirit and intensity of Miami athletics.
Sebastian the Ibis
The official mascot is Sebastian the Ibis, a character steeped in local folklore. The American white ibis is known for its bravery, often being the last bird to take shelter before a hurricane and the first to emerge after the storm passes. This resilience made it the perfect symbol for a university whose athletic teams are named the Hurricanes. Sebastian is a beloved figure, pumping up the crowd and embodying the fearless spirit of ‘The U’.
